#[non_exhaustive]pub struct AwsLambdaFunctionDetails { /* private fields */ }
Expand description
Details about an Lambda function's configuration.

sourcepub fn kms_key_arn(&self) -> Option<&str>
pub fn kms_key_arn(&self) -> Option<&str>
The KMS key that is used to encrypt the function's environment variables. This key is only returned if you've configured a customer managed customer managed key.
sourcepub fn last_modified(&self) -> Option<&str>
pub fn last_modified(&self) -> Option<&str>
Indicates when the function was last updated.
Uses the date-time
format specified in RFC 3339 section 5.6, Internet Date/Time Format. The value cannot contain spaces. For example, 2020-03-22T13:22:13.933Z
.

sourcepub fn architectures(&self) -> Option<&[String]>
pub fn architectures(&self) -> Option<&[String]>
The instruction set architecture that the function uses. Valid values are x86_64
or arm64
.
sourcepub fn package_type(&self) -> Option<&str>
pub fn package_type(&self) -> Option<&str>
The type of deployment package that's used to deploy the function code to Lambda. Set to Image
for a container image and Zip
for a .zip file archive.
